The HP 15.6" Business and Student Laptop offers a solid mix of features aimed at users looking for a reliable machine for everyday tasks, office work, and study. It comes with a large 15.6-inch screen, but the resolution of 1366x768 is quite basic compared to sharper Full HD displays commonly found today, which means visuals may not be very crisp. The 16GB of RAM and 1TB SSD storage are strong points, providing plenty of memory for multitasking and ample fast storage for files and programs. The processor is an Intel Celeron with a 2.8 GHz speed, which is on the lower end. This means it handles basic jobs well, like web browsing, document editing, and video calls, but may struggle with more demanding software or multitasking heavy apps.
The laptop runs Windows 11 Pro and includes Microsoft Office, making it a good choice for students or business users who need productivity tools right away. It also features Wi-Fi 6 and Bluetooth 5, ensuring modern and reliable wireless connections. Weighing about 6 pounds, this laptop is somewhat on the heavier side, which might affect portability if you plan to carry it often. The anti-glare screen coating can help reduce eye strain in bright environments. The keyboard includes a numeric keypad, which is handy for data entry tasks. Ports include three USB 3.0 slots plus Ethernet, covering most connectivity needs.
Battery life is described as long, so you can expect moderate usage time rather than all-day endurance. This HP laptop suits students or business users who prioritize decent memory and storage, bundled software, and solid connectivity over high-end processing power or display quality.
The Apple 2025 MacBook Air 13-inch Laptop with the M4 chip is a powerful and highly portable device that excels in performance and ease of use. With a 10-core CPU and 16GB of unified memory, this laptop handles multitasking, video editing, and graphically intensive games smoothly. The 256GB SSD storage provides quick access to files and applications, although heavy users might need additional storage solutions.
The 13.6-inch Liquid Retina display offers vibrant colors and sharp details, making it ideal for content creators and media consumption. The battery life is impressive, lasting up to 18 hours, which supports extended use without frequent recharging. It features two Thunderbolt 4 ports, a MagSafe charging port, and a headphone jack, ensuring versatile connectivity options. The laptop's build is sleek and lightweight at 2.73 pounds, making it easy to carry around.
The integrated graphics card is suitable for most tasks but may not meet the high demands of professional gamers or users who require specialized graphics-intensive applications. The device runs on macOS, which is user-friendly and integrates well with other Apple devices for a cohesive ecosystem experience. While the midnight color gives it a modern look, the higher price point might be a consideration for budget-conscious buyers. The Touch ID feature adds convenience and security, and the enhanced camera and audio support high-quality video calls and multimedia experiences. The 2025 MacBook Air is ideal for users seeking performance, portability, and a seamless Apple ecosystem.
The Apple 2024 MacBook Pro with M4 chip is a powerful laptop designed for performance enthusiasts and creative professionals. It features a 10-core CPU and GPU, capable of handling demanding tasks like video editing and gaming, making it a strong choice for users who need high processing power. Its 14.2-inch Liquid Retina XDR display offers stunning visuals with up to 1600 nits brightness, perfect for graphic design and media consumption.
With 16GB of unified memory and 512GB SSD storage, the MacBook Pro provides ample space and efficiency for multitasking. The all-day battery life, which lasts up to 16 hours of web browsing, ensures you can work without frequent recharges, enhancing its portability.
The M4 chip excels with apps like Microsoft 365 and Adobe Creative Cloud running smoothly on macOS, making this laptop a great fit for creative workflows and productivity tasks. Furthermore, seamless integration with other Apple devices, like iPhones, improves user experience for those already in the Apple ecosystem. However, the price point may be steep for casual users or those on a budget, as premium features come at a cost. While the laptop is equipped with various ports, including Thunderbolt 4 and HDMI, it lacks legacy ports like USB-A or an Ethernet port, which may require additional adapters for some users.
